摘要
以Worldview 30cm HD立体影像为例,探讨了亚米级高分辨率立体卫星影像在大比例尺地形图测绘生产中的应用,形成了一套基于高分辨率卫星影像的立体测图流程。以南京市某测区为例开展立体测图试验,通过对成图精度进行分析,结果表明,采用0.3 m空间分辨率Worldview立体卫星影像生成大比例尺地形图是可行的,能基本满足试验区1∶2000测图精度要求,但有一些地物无法准确判读与定位,需要外业实地补测。
Taking Worldview 30 cm HD stereo image as an example,this paper discusses the application of high resolution stereo satellite images with sub-meter accuracy in large scale topographic map production and explores a workflow of large scale stereo mapping based on high resolution satellite images.Then a stereo mapping experiment is carried out in a study area located in Nanjing and the mapping accuracy is analyzed.The experiment result shows that it is feasible to produce large scale topographic map using Worldview 30 cm HD stereo image and the mapping accuracy basically meets the requirements of 1∶2000 scale mapping.However,some objects can not be accurately interpreted and positioned from image,which requires field surveying and mapping.
